C2H5OH (ethanol) is a relatively small molecule compared to the hydrocarbons in gasoline mixtures. Even if it didn't have that one oxygen atom, it'd still have fewer hydrogens to use than the main components of gasoline. And those gasoline compounds can be arbitrarily longer than their minimum molecule designation.
It's the single oxygen atom and the fewer total number of hydrogens, combined.

Before the war, roughly a third of the world’s fertilizer ingredients and a fifth of its oil supplies passed every day through the Strait of Hormuz, a narrow waterway off Iran’s southern coast. But since the U.S. and Israel attacked Iran on Feb. 28, the strait has been effectively closed by Tehran, leaving scores of tankers stranded.
The strait’s closure has driven up global prices for fertilizer and for the diesel fuel that powers most of America’s heavy agricultural equipment.
The double whammy is hitting farmers just as they head into the spring planting season.
“This is that perfect storm where everything comes together and hammers the farmer,” said Mueller, who also serves as the president of the Iowa Corn Growers Association.
Mueller said his fertilizer supplier was selling a nitrogen fertilizer he needs for $795 per ton on Feb. 22, a few days before the war started. At the end of March, it was $990, Mueller said, a nearly $200 jump in just a few weeks.
Meanwhile, the price he’s paying for diesel has jumped, too. Diesel is now averaging $5.51 nationwide, up from $3.76 right before the war, according to AAA.
Mueller said he got most of the fertilizer he needs for spring before the war — but had to buy some at the higher prices. He’s holding off on purchasing the additional fertilizer he needs for summer, hoping prices will come down.
President Donald Trump’s tariffs have also added to the cost of goods that farmers import from overseas — and frustrated many of the foreign buyers of America’s agricultural products.
“Our government made our life more difficult by walking away from trade deals or instituting tariffs or just basically making our customers angry — our customers being other nations and companies in other nations,” said Mueller.

from what I understand there are only a few ways to make ethanol that is decently net positive. This was why it was huge in brazil because it works well with sugarcane but that is because the fiber is burnt to provide the energy for the distinllation and such. using corn or sugarbeets is anemic and you use the waste product as animal feed to up its anemic returns. There's two ways main bases to make ethanol at scale:
sugar
cellulose
The sugar path is what we're doing everywhere with corn and elsewhere with sugar cane/beet waste. The switch grass is a cellulose path, but switch grass isn't the only feedstock that can be used. Its talked about the most because switch grass is really easy to grow.
Industrial cellulose ethanol is still only a tiny industry with only 3 commercial scale plants in operation today in the world (2 in Brazil, 1 in China). It has promise to be more, but its been small for decades.
The biggest push for cellulose approach is for making Sustainable Aviation Fuel (SAF).

We've planted approximately 95 million acres worth of corn this year. That's about 384,000 square km, for normal people. In 2025, the United States generated 4.43 thousand terawatthours (TWh) of electricity.
Per Wikipedia, the world's largest photovoltaic power station is China's Talatan Solar Park, which generates 18,000 GWh annually. It occupies an area of about 420 square km.
4,430 TWh/18,000 GWh gives us 246.1 Talatan Solar Parks to power the country photovoltaically, occupying a combined area of 103,000 square km, or around a quarter of the total corn area. That's not even very efficient in terms of annual electrical generation per unit land area, and it's a mere fraction of the land we waste on corn
